I’m a terminal manager for a carrier that pays %. Everyone of my drivers can come into my office and I’ll show them exactly what the linehaul is. My office does have work that the customer requires us to build some FSC into the linehaul, but I have a spreadsheet showing how everything breaks out. I’ve never hid a rate from any of my drivers.
I know there’s companies who pay a higher %, but at the end of the day you always need to ask, a % of what rate per mile? 30% of 2.85 mile is still less then 25% off 4.25 mile.bumper Jack and CAXPT Thank this. -
